Dr. Sharon R. Cabansag is a native of Sturgis and returned in 2005 to institute Family Medicine as a complement to her father's practice at Southwestern Michigan Laser Clinic.

Dr. Cabansag served her residency in Family Medicine at St. John Hospital and Medical Center in Detroit, Michigan from 2002-2005 where she served as chief resident during her last year. Her Doctorate of Medicine was granted by the University of the East Ramon Magsaysay Memorial Medical Center, College of Medicine, Quezon City, Philippines.

In addition to her schooling, she conducted research at Louisiana State University Medical Center Department of Pharmacology and Experimental Therapeutics in New Orleans; and worked at Rockefeller University Hospital, Biochemical Genetics and Metabolism Laboratory in New York.

Dr. Cabansag is Board Certified by the American Board of Family Medicine.

About Family Practice

The family physician's care is both personal and comprehensive and not limited by age, sex, organ system or type of problem, be it biological, behavioral or social. This care is based on knowledge of the patient in the context of the family and the community, emphasizing disease prevention and health promotion. When referral is indicated, the family physician refers the patient to other specialists or caregivers but remains the coordinator of the patient's health care.

Family medicine is a three-dimensional specialty, incorporating (1) knowledge, (2) skill and (3) process. Although knowledge and skill may be shared with other specialties, the family medicine process is unique. At the center of this process is the patient-physician relationship with the patient viewed in the context of the family. It is the extent to which this relationship is valued, developed, nurtured and maintained that distinguishes family medicine from all other specialties.
